6 most underwhelming Konoha 11 members, ranked

Konoha 11 is a powerful group of ninja of Naruto's generation, consisting of Shinobi from the various teams. This group, excluding Sasuke, consisted of Team 7, Team 8, Team 10, and, of course, Team Guy. All of these ninja were labeled to be the future of Konoha, and they certainly carried immense talent.

While quite a few of the Konoha 11 ended up meeting fans' expectations and making it to the next level, there were others that, for one reason or another, were underwhelming and definitely not as interesting to witness throughout the story.

Kiba Inuzuka

Kiba Inuzuka Most underwhelming Konoha 11 members naruto

  • Konoha Team: Team 8

  • Team Leader: Kurenai Yuhi

  • Kekkei Genkai: None

  • Ninja Rank: Chunin

Kiba of the Inuzuka clan is one of the most underwhelming characters in all of Naruto. Kiba was a member of Team 8 and really a very interesting character at the beginning of the series. He also fought Naruto Uzumaki in the Chunin Exams and really held his own.

In fact, he also played a big role in the Sasuke Retrieval arc. But from then on, his importance in the story diminished. He turned into a joke by the time of the Fourth Great Ninja War, and it wouldn't be a stretch to say that he became irrelevant. As a member of the Konoha 11, he definitely flopped, and in the Boruto era, he's pretty much irrelevant and not even talked about, which is really unfortunate.

Shino Aburame

  • Konoha Team: Team 8

  • Team Leader: Kurenai Yuhi

  • Kekkei Genkai: None

  • Ninja Rank: Jonin

Shino was quite an underrated character in the first part of Naruto. Although he hardly ever got his flowers, he was always the most composed of the Konoha 11, keeping his true strength to himself. He was seen fighting some very impressive battles in the Chunin Exams, and more importantly, later in the story, he also battled Kankuro.

Although he got small moments here and there in the war, Shino was largely neglected as a character, and it was pretty clear to see that the writer didn't really care about him. With that, he became one of the most underwhelming Konoha 11 ninja. In the Boruto era, Shino is officially seen as a Ninja Academy instructor, but unlike Iruka, he is quite strong. We would all appreciate his character a lot more if he was properly focused on by the writers.

Hinata Hyuga

  • Konoha Team: Team 8

  • Team Leader: Kurenai Yuhi

  • Kekkei Genkai: Byakugan

  • Ninja Rank: Chunin

While Hinata certainly received better treatment than the likes of Kiba, she was still a largely neglected character. Her character started off incredibly well when she fought Neji during the Chunin Exams arc and used Naruto as her sole inspiration. She tried her best not only to fight against her cousin but at the same time to prove to the world that she was also a capable fighter.

Hinata did phenomenally well in her fight despite losing; but after that, her role in the story diminished quite a bit. Although she played an important role in Pain's Arc, she was only used to unleash Naruto Uzumaki's true power. During the war, she did nothing of note, and at the end of it all, despite all the talent she had, she ended up being a housewife and gave up her ninja duties. In Boruto, she is largely irrelevant and was eventually sealed away by Kawaki, cutting her out of the plot entirely. As a Konoha 11 member, Hinata is definitely underwhelming and has wasted a lot of potential as a ninja.

Rock Lee

  • Konoha Team: Team Guy

  • Team Leader: Might Guy

  • Kekkei Genkai: None

  • Ninja Rank: Jonin

Rock Lee was clearly a fan favorite at the beginning of the story. His story arc was compelling and touched the fans, as quite a few people could relate to him. His fight against Gaara echoes through history even now; but that's all this character has going for himself.

Rock Lee was largely neglected in the second part of Naruto, and his story arc was left largely untouched. All the fans were extremely disappointed to see how he was treated in the war. Although he is strong and still has a very interesting story, he can only be considered an underwhelming ninja in the Konoha 11 in the grand scheme of things.

Choji Akimichi

  • Konoha Team: Team 10

  • Team Leader: Asuma Sarutobi

  • Kekkei Genkai: None

  • Ninja Rank: Chunin

Choji was never the most interesting character in Naruto, and fans didn't care much for him. But despite all this, he received some attention at the beginning of the story from Masashi Kishimoto. Even then, however, he was largely underpowered and fell flat.

In the Sasuke Retrieval mission, we got a very interesting fight around him. However, this was the last we saw of him in action for a very long time. Although he got his moments here and there in the war, he was largely irrelevant and became even more boring as the plot continued. The fans didn't seem to care enough because Kishimoto never put much effort into his character, making him and underwhelming ninja as well.

  • Konoha Team: Team Guy

  • Team Leader: Might Guy

  • Kekkei Genkai: None

  • Ninja Rank: Jonin

Quite simply, the biggest flop in all of Konoha 11 was Tenten. She was introduced as a member of Team Guy and considering that this team had an extra year of experience over everyone else, fans expected great things from them. Neji certainly lived up to those expectations. However, Tenten didn't. This was a very confusing decision by the author, largely because he doesn't know how to write his female characters properly.

What made this character arc even more terrifying was the fact that she had her own goals in the beginning. She wanted to become a powerful ninja like Tsunade; however, the two were not even seen interacting throughout the series. Tenten mastered quite a few weapons, but that was all there was to her character. In fact, even her own teacher, Guy, paid her no attention and was solely focused on Lee. She was failed as a ninja by her superiors and as a result ended up flopping as a member of the Konoha 11. That said, she still ended up rising high and gaining the rank of a Jonin by the Boruto era. Unfortunately, she is still not focused on in the story, which is definitely unfortunate.
